Output 837260b2d5ead1cc2626c10e9e02f88b8e315079ee9af1ef7958869ac7367e29:0

value
11798809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6be2315170a1c245da039f1594f0008089f4325 OP_EQUAL
address
3MGUJYmtuayd991NLGSvkdbNbKvdaJGddG
transaction
837260b2d5ead1cc2626c10e9e02f88b8e315079ee9af1ef7958869ac7367e29
spent
true